This part is OK.

> +@samp{bnd0raw} through @samp{bnd3raw} for i386, amd64 and x32.  Hardware
> +representation of the bound registers effectively @samp{bnd0} through

What does "effectively" mean in this context?

> +@samp{bnd3}.  The bounds are unsigned effective addresses, and are

And what does "effective" mean here?

> +inclusive. The upper bounds are architecturally represented in 1's
            ^^
Two spaces are needed here.

> +User representation of the bound registers.  Upper bound value stores
> +the effective address of the bound, i.e. the one's complement of the

Same question about "effective".  Also, please insert either a comma
',' or @: after "i.e.", to make sure the second period is not rendered
by TeX as an end of a sentence.
